Covid-19: deconfinement will be done "very gradually" by the summer, announces Gabriel Attal

2021-04-27T19:48:56.884Z


The relaxation of health restrictions will be done "very gradually" in order to avoid an epidemic outbreak, the spokesperson stressed.


Italy is partially reopening its bars, restaurants, cinemas and theaters.

A few weeks earlier, we were envious of scenes of jubilation in the busy streets of London, the day the terraces reopened.

But according to Gabriel Attal, the same scenario is not envisaged in France: deconfinement will be done surely, but slowly.

Invited on LCI this Monday morning, the government spokesperson insisted on the necessary caution to be adopted.

After the lifting of travel restrictions on May 3, the first reopening "mid-May" would only constitute a "first step", insists Gabriel Attal.

Neither the precise date nor the establishments concerned have yet been set, but Emmanuel Macron will return "soon to the French" to "give them the stages of the reopening calendar" of certain terraces and places of culture.

"Things will be done very gradually between now and the summer, we are not going to reopen everything at once, that would not be responsible," he asserts, criticizing the management of neighboring countries in the process.

"We have seen certain countries around us, such as Germany, Italy, which opened a lot of places at once and unfortunately had to close them a few days or a few weeks later".

According to him, "we must find the best time, it depends on two things: first, the work of the government on these stages must have advanced.

I can tell you that it is moving forward, we have regular meetings to prepare for these deadlines, ”he explained.

Territorialization is "an option, a possibility"

"The second thing is that the announcements must be made sufficiently in advance so that the people who work in the places that have been closed can obviously prepare for their reopening, because that requires a great deal of organization and preparation. ", he added.

"Territorialization is an option on the table, a possibility, there is no decision taken or announcement on this subject," he added regarding the lifting of restrictions. However, if so, this will not necessarily lead to continued travel restrictions in some areas. Territorialization would therefore apply more to reopening.
